In this paper, 5 species of Monalocoris Dahlbom and 9 species of Eccritotars ini (Hemiptera, Miridae, Bryocorinae) are reported, including 3 new species (M ona locoris fulviscutellatus sp. nov. and Monalocoris nigroflavis sp. nov.and Monalocoris ochraceus sp. nov.). Monalocoris amamianus Yasunaga,and Di oclerus t hailandensis Stonedahl and Ernestinus tetrastigma Y asunaga are newly recorded in China. The type specimens are preserved in the Dep artment of Biology, Nankai University, Tianjin, China.Monalocoris Dahlbom, 1851Monalocoris amamianus Yasunaga, 2000Distribution. Guangxi, Yunnan.Monalocoris filicis (Linnaeus, 1758) Distribution in China:Heilongjiang,Shanxi,Gansu,Hubei,Zhejiang,Fujian,Jiangx i,Hunan,Guangdong,Guangxi,Sichuan,Guizhou,Yunnan.Monalocoris fulviscutellatus sp. nov.(Figs.1,8,1 3) Body light yellowish brown, costal margin weakly convex.; Head light yellowish brown. Clypeus brown. Rostrum reaching anterior coxa.Antennal segment Ⅰ light yellowish brown with a brown ring at basal 1/3;segment Ⅱ light yellowish brown with apical 1/3-2/5 yellowish brown, Ⅲ and Ⅳyellowish brown (Fig. 1). Pronotum yellowish brown, posteriorly with tiny shallow pits, slightly shiny. Collar light yellowish brown.Calli shiny, laterally reaching lateral side of pronotum (Figs. 1, 8), callus length about 1/4 times as long as pronotal lateral margin. Scutellum yellowish white. Clavus yellowish brown, its inner margin and commissu re area brown, sometimes its basal half suffused with brown. Corium light yellow,semihyaline, inner apical 2/3-4/5 suffused with brown, anterior margin of this brown area obscure, and obliquely extending from middle of vein Cu to apical 3/4 of ou ter margin of clavus; apical 1/3 of outer corial margin brownish, sometimes forming a longitudinal marking. Embolium light yellow, apical half yellowish brown. Cune us light yellow, semihyaline, basal inner angle brown and apical area yellowish bro wn, cuneus inner margin slightly concave (Fig.13). Membrane pale smoky, mottled. Leg s light yellowish brown with a subapical dark ring. Thorax ventrally yellowish bro wn, abdominal venter yellowish brown or black brown, posterior margin of abdominal s egments Ⅲ-Ⅶ suffused with black. Measurements (mm). Head length 0.2, width 0.6, vertex width 0.3, antennal segment length: 0.3, 0.7, 0.4, 0.3. Collar width 0.4; pronotal length 0.6 , width 1.1. Scutellum length 0.3. Claval commissure length 0.6; corium length 1. 1, wid th 0.6; length of cuneus 0.5; cuneus apex to membrane apex 0.4. Body length 2 .8. Holotype ♀, Yunnan Prov., Xiaomenglong, alt. 810?m, 30 Mar. 1957, LIU Da- Hua leg. (deposited in the Institute of Zoology, Chinese Academy of Sciences). Para type 1♀, Yu nnan Prov., Jinghong County (22.0°N, 100.8°E): Damenglong, alt. 700?m, 10 A pr. 1957, PU Fu-Ji leg. Distribution. China. Related to M. flaviceps Poppius, 1915, but the latter species is larger (abo ut 4?mm), membrane black with pale apex, and antennal segment Ⅰ completely yell ow.Monalocoris nigroflavis sp. nov.(Figs.4, 6, 9,17,18, 20, 21) Head dark yellowish brown. Clypeus black brown. Lateral side of head and buccula black brown or brown. Area around eye yellowish brown, Frons basally slightly black brown. Rostrum reaching anterior coxa. Antennal segments Ⅰ a nd Ⅱ light yellowish brown; apical 2/5-1/2 of Ⅱ dark yellowish brown to black brown;Ⅲ and Ⅳ dark brown or brown. Pronotum black brown, area near posterior margin of pronotum pale yellowish brown, postero-lateral angle light yellowish brown or posteriorly with a large yellowish brown and wide short U-shaped marking, or pronotum dark brown with a large paler area as shown in Fig.4; sometimes pronotum dark yellowish brown and dorso-laterally blackish brown. Pronotal disk convex as shown in Fig.6 and de clivous obviously after the convex area. Collar yellowish brown.
